1

Senior Software Developer In Test Jobs in Annapolis, MD

BCforward's team of dedicated staffing professionals has placed thousands of talented people over the past decade, with retention rates that are consistently higher than the industry average. SDET ...

Senior Software Engineer

Washington, DC ยท On-site

$191K - $254K/yr

Candidates with a background in embedded systems are encouraged to apply, though it is not a strict ... Create and maintain automated tests to validate system functionality * Debug complex software ...

Senior Software Engineer

Jessup, MD ยท On-site

$126K - $166K/yr

Senior Software Engineer Step into a high-impact Senior Software Engineer opportunity with a ... implementation, test, factory deployment, and life-cycle maintenance Expert in C and C++ in ...

Senior Software Engineer

Washington, DC ยท On-site

$107K - $195K/yr

Participate in test, staging, and production deployments , ensuring system reliability and ... Utilize DevOps tools like GitLab or Jenkins for CI/CD practices. * Monitor automated system ...

Senior Software Engineer

Hyattsville, MD ยท On-site

$107K - $195K/yr

Participate in test, staging, and production deployments , ensuring system reliability and ... Utilize DevOps tools like GitLab or Jenkins for CI/CD practices. * Monitor automated system ...

Senior Software Engineer

Takoma Park, MD ยท On-site

$107K - $195K/yr

Participate in test, staging, and production deployments , ensuring system reliability and ... Utilize DevOps tools like GitLab or Jenkins for CI/CD practices. * Monitor automated system ...

Senior Software Engineer

Washington, DC ยท On-site

$107K - $195K/yr

Participate in test, staging, and production deployments , ensuring system reliability and ... Utilize DevOps tools like GitLab or Jenkins for CI/CD practices. * Monitor automated system ...

Role : SDET Location : Washington, DC ( Onsite ) Job Type : Contract / Full Time Extensive ... CI/CD and DevOps: Proficiency with Continuous Integration/Continuous Deployment (CI/CD) pipelines ...

Senior Software Engineer

Annapolis Junction, MD ยท On-site

$134K - $177K/yr

... systems in accordance with project requirements. Works effectively both independently and ... test outcomes. Additionally, the Sr. Software Engineer addresses and resolves software issues ...

next page

Showing results 1-20

Senior Software Developer In Test information

See Annapolis, MD salary details

$15

$61

$86

How much do senior software developer in test jobs pay per hour?

As of Jun 23, 2026, the average hourly pay for senior software developer in test in Annapolis, MD is $61.11, according to ZipRecruiter salary data. Most workers in this role earn between $51.88 and $68.51 per hour, depending on experience, location, and employer.

What is the difference between Senior Software Developer In Test vs Software Development Engineer in Test?

AspectSenior Software Developer In TestSoftware Development Engineer in Test
CredentialsTypically requires a software engineering degree and testing certificationsSimilar credentials, often with certifications in testing tools or automation
Work EnvironmentWorks closely with development teams to design and implement automated testsFocuses on developing testing frameworks and automation tools within development teams
Industry UsageCommonly used in software companies emphasizing quality assuranceWidely used in tech firms with a focus on continuous integration and delivery
Search & Comparison IntentOften compared for seniority and scope of testing responsibilitiesCompared for automation skills and development focus

Both roles involve testing and automation, but Senior Software Developer In Test typically has more leadership responsibilities and strategic testing planning, while Software Development Engineer in Test focuses more on developing testing tools and automation frameworks within the development process.

What are some common challenges faced by Senior Software Developers in Test, and how can they be addressed?

Senior Software Developers in Test often encounter challenges such as balancing test automation coverage with tight deadlines, keeping up with evolving technologies, and ensuring effective communication between development and QA teams. Addressing these challenges involves prioritizing automation efforts based on risk and business impact, continually updating technical skills, and fostering a collaborative environment through regular cross-team meetings. Proactively sharing knowledge and advocating for best testing practices also help streamline workflows and maintain high-quality standards.

What is a Senior Software Developer In Test?

A Senior Software Developer In Test (SDET) is an experienced software professional who is responsible for designing, developing, and maintaining automated test frameworks and tools to ensure software quality. SDETs work closely with development and QA teams to create automated tests that validate application functionality, performance, and security. They possess strong programming skills, a deep understanding of software testing methodologies, and often contribute to both the development and testing aspects of a project. Senior SDETs also mentor junior team members and help shape best practices for software testing within their organization.

What are the key skills and qualifications needed to thrive as a Senior Software Developer In Test, and why are they important?

To thrive as a Senior Software Developer In Test, you need advanced programming skills, expertise in test automation, and a solid understanding of software development and QA methodologies, typically supported by a degree in computer science or a related field. Proficiency with test automation frameworks (such as Selenium, Cypress, or Appium), continuous integration systems (like Jenkins or GitHub Actions), and relevant certifications (e.g., ISTQB) is highly valuable. Attention to detail, problem-solving abilities, and effective communication are critical soft skills for collaborating with developers and ensuring high-quality releases. These skills and qualities are essential for identifying issues early, optimizing testing processes, and delivering reliable software in fast-paced development environments.
What are popular job titles related to Senior Software Developer In Test jobs in Annapolis, MD? For Senior Software Developer In Test jobs in Annapolis, MD, the most frequently searched job titles are:
What job categories do people searching Senior Software Developer In Test jobs in Annapolis, MD look for? The top searched job categories for Senior Software Developer In Test jobs in Annapolis, MD are:
What cities near Annapolis, MD are hiring for Senior Software Developer In Test jobs? Cities near Annapolis, MD with the most Senior Software Developer In Test job openings:
Infographic showing various Senior Software Developer In Test job openings in Annapolis, MD as of June 2026, with employment types broken down into 79% Full Time, and 21% Contract. Highlights an 95% In-person, and 5% Hybrid job distribution, with an average salary of $127,106 per year, or $61.1 per hour.

Senior Software Developer - TS required to apply - Wash DC + HYBRID

Bow Wave LLC

Washington, DC โ€ข Hybrid

$61.75 - $81.50/hr

Full-time

Posted 4 days ago


Job description

ONLY QUALIFIED CANDIDATES NEED APPLY
SENIOR SOFTWARE DEVELOPER - FULL STACK, JAVA SPRING, POSTGRESQL
Role Overview:
The Senior Software Developer will lead the design and development of the new application.
This role will design and implement backed APIs using Java Spring Boot, build secure and
responsive UIs in React, and develop optimized PostgreSQL schemas and queries. The ideal
candidate will have proven experience delivering large-scale enterprise applications from
concept through deployment.
Responsibilities:
โ€ข Lead full-stack design and development using Java Spring Boot and React.
โ€ข Design and implement normalized PostgreSQL schemas and entity relationships supporting
system scalability.
โ€ข Develop and maintain secure RESTful APIs for data access and integration.
โ€ข Implement modern UI components using React, TypeScript/JavaScript, and reusable design
patterns.
โ€ข Lead and document data migration efforts, ensuring integrity and consistency between
legacy and new systems.
โ€ข Plan and execute application deployments, version control, and CI/CD pipelines.
โ€ข Mentor mid-level developers and provide technical leadership.
โ€ข Ensure compliance with 508 accessibility, enterprise security practices, and other practices
as needed.
Required Qualifications:
โ€ข 8+ years in software development; 5+ years working with Java Spring Boot; 3+ years React.
โ€ข Strong experience with PostgreSQL database design, normalization, and optimization.